The New Jersey equine industry–valued at more than $3.5 billion–generates $1.1 billion annually in positive impact on the New Jersey economy, according to a new study released by the Rutgers Equine Science Center.

The incidence of Lyme disease in Vermont has seen a “sudden and dramatic increase” since the end of 2003, a Shelburne veterinarian says.
